In fact, according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, at least one in three Americans say they don\u2019t get the recommended seven to eight hours of shuteye per night.&nbsp;<sup>[1]<\/sup>&nbsp;This lack of sufficient sleep\u2014known as sleep deprivation\u2014can have serious consequences for your health.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>How do you know if you\u2019re actually suffering from sleep deprivation\u2014and what can you do to get your sleep back on track? Keep reading for everything you need to know about sleep deprivation, including causes, symptoms, and how to treat it.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">What is sleep deprivation?&nbsp;<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Simply put, sleep deprivation when you don\u2019t get enough sleep or you don\u2019t get&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/what-is-sleep-quality\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">quality sleep<\/a>.&nbsp;<sup>[2]<\/sup>&nbsp;It can lead to an overall diminished well-being.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s a level of sleep loss that causes a disruption to your body\u2019s natural rhythms, and when it gets bad enough, impairs your ability to simply function and go about your day,\u201d explains&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.linkedin.com\/in\/todd-anderson-b563ba32\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Todd Anderson<\/a>, co-founder and chief brand officer of&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/dreamrecovery.io\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Dream Performance &amp; Recovery<\/a>.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Sleep deprivation is like \u201crunning on empty,\u201d adds Anderson. \u201cIt drains your energy, fogs your mind, and leaves your body struggling to keep up.\u201d&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Over time, this lack of rest can take a serious toll on your health, weakening your&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/sleep-and-immune-system\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">immune system<\/a>, slowing down your&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/sleep-and-metabolism\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">metabolism<\/a>, and even impacting your mood and decision-making, he says. &n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Causes of sleep deprivation&nbsp;<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>&#8220;Sleep deprivation is often caused by the person themselves not getting enough sleep, such as college students pulling an all-nighter to study,\u201d says&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.laent.com\/about\/meet-the-doctors\/dr-cyrus-haghighian\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Cyrus Haghighian<\/a>, MD, board-certified sleep doctor at Los Angeles Center for Ear, Nose, Throat, and Allergy.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Additionally, if you have chronic&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/tips-for-treating-insomnia\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">insomnia<\/a>, or difficulty&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/how-long-should-it-take-to-fall-asleep\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">falling asleep<\/a>&nbsp;or staying asleep, that might cause you to not be getting a sufficient amount of sleep,&#8221; adds Haghighian.&nbsp;<sup>[3]<\/sup><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>According to Johns Hopkins Medicine, besides having an irregular schedule or suffering from insomnia, some of the other main causes of sleep deprivation include:&nbsp;<sup>[4]<\/sup><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/sleep-disorders\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Sleep disorders<\/a>\u00a0such as\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/sleep-apnea-guide\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">sleep apnea<\/a>,\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/what-is-narcolepsy\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">narcolepsy<\/a>, and\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/restless-legs-syndrome-and-sleep\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">restless legs syndrome<\/a>\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Health conditions such as\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/depression-and-sleep\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">depression<\/a>,\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/back-pain\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">chronic pain<\/a>,\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/cancer-sleep-tips\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">cancer<\/a>, or\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/alzheimers-sleep-connection\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Alzheimer\u2019s<\/a><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Being over age 65<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Experiencing life changes such as having a baby\u00a0<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Sleep deprivation symptoms&nbsp;<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>If you\u2019re going about your day feeling tired and low energy, there&#8217;s a chance you may be suffering from sleep deprivation. But that&#8217;s only a part of the larger picture.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>&#8220;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/excessive-daytime-sleepiness\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Excessive daytime sleepiness<\/a>, or hypersomnia, is a very common symptom if someone is not getting enough sleep,&#8221; says Haghighian.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>You may also experience symptoms like impaired memory and learning, especially in the short term.&nbsp;<sup>[4]&nbsp;<\/sup><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>&#8220;Behavioral issues may arise in children that are not getting enough sleep,\u201d adds Haghighian. \u201cIn adults, mood disorders such as&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/sleeping-with-anxiety\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">anxiety<\/a>&nbsp;and depression can result from not getting enough sleep.&#8221;&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How to treat sleep deprivation<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>There are a few things you can do to improve your nighttime routine and hopefully get more\u2014and better\u2014rest as a result. To help ease sleep deprivation, try the following.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Create a routine:\u00a0<\/strong>This is where\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/sleep-hygiene\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">good sleep hygiene<\/a>\u00a0comes into play. &#8220;Stick to a regular sleep schedule, develop a calming bedtime wind down, and ensure your sleep environment is comfortable,&#8221; says Anderson.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Try\u00a0<\/str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.saatva.com\/blog\/cognitive-behavioral-therapy-insomnia\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\"><strong>Cognitive Behavioral Therapy<\/strong><\/a><strong>:<\/strong>\u00a0This is a deliberately targeted approach to changing thoughts and habits that disrupt sleep.\u00a0<sup>[5]<\/sup>\u00a0&#8220;I find daily stresses cause many issues with sleep, so therapy is a great way to create a stress management plan,&#8221; says Anderson.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Practice stress management:\u00a0<\/strong>Anxiety and stress can keep you up at night.\u00a0<sup>[6]<\/sup>\u00a0&#8220;Use techniques like meditation, deep breathing, and mindfulness to lower anxiety and encourage relaxation,&#8221; suggests Anderson.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Incorporate exercise:<\/strong>\u00a0Getting regular exercise can help your body relax at the end of the day.\u00a0<sup>[7]<\/sup>\u00a0&#8220;Engage in regular physical activity to improve sleep quality,\u201d says Anderson. \u201cExercise is net positive for sleep in all forms.&#8221;\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Seek medical attention:<\/strong>\u00a0If at-home remedies don\u2019t work after a couple of weeks, it\u2019s important to speak with your healthcare provider to determine if an underlying condition is to blame for your sleep deprivation.\u00a0<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">FAQs&nbsp;<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Can you recover from sleep deprivation?<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Yes, you can recover from sleep deprivation. It requires improving your routine and sleep hygiene and getting more and better quality sleep with fewer disruptions. If at-home remedies don\u2019t work, you may need to see a medical professional to find out what the underlying cause of your sleep deprivation is.\u00a0<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How do doctors deal with sleep deprivation?<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Doctors diagnose and treat sleep deprivation in a variety of ways with different levels of intervention. They\u2019ll usually start with self-care such as changing sleep habits and bedtime routines before going the medication route.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How long does it take to make up for a sleep deficit?<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Studies have shown it can take around four days&nbsp;to recover from just one night&#8217;s lost sleep.&nbsp;<sup>[8]<\/sup><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><em>Looking for more ways to improve your sleep so you can get over your sleep deprivation?
